Right to be Informed: You have the right to be provided with information regarding our Personal Data collection and privacy practices.
Right to Know, Access Rights: You have the right to confirm whether we collect Personal Data about you, as well as to know which Personal Data we specifically hold about you and receive a copy of such or access it. You may exercise your right by sending us email at: [email protected].
Right to Correction/ Rectification: You have the right to request the updating of Personal Data that is not correct, taking into account the nature of the processing and the purposes. You may exercise your right by sending us email at: [email protected], and for certain types of Personal Data, you may correct the information directly through the Extension settings.
Right to Be Forgotten, Right to Deletion: You have the right to request the erasure of certain Personal Data if specific conditions are satisfied. This right is not absolute. We may reject your request under certain circumstances, including where we must retain the data in order to comply with legal obligations or defend against legal claims, other legitimate interests such as record keeping with regards to our engagements, completing transactions, providing a good or service that you requested, taking actions reasonably anticipated within the context of our ongoing business relationship with you, fulfilling the terms of a written warranty, detecting security incidents, protecting against malicious, deceptive, fraudulent, or illegal activity, or prosecuting those responsible for such activities; debugging products to identify and repair errors that impair existing intended functionality; exercising free speech, ensuring the right of another consumer to exercise their free speech rights, or exercising another right provided for by law; engaging in public or peer-reviewed scientific, historical, or statistical research in the public interest that adheres to all other applicable ethics and privacy laws, when the information’s deletion may likely render impossible or seriously impair the research’s achievement, if you previously provided informed consent. You may exercise your right by sending us email at: [email protected]. You do not need to create an account with us to submit a deletion request.
Right to Restriction of Processing: You may be entitled to limit the purposes for which we process your Personal Data if one of the following conditions are satisfied: where the accuracy of the Personal Data is contested by you, for a period enabling us to verify the accuracy of the Personal Data; where the processing is unlawful and you oppose the erasure of the Personal Data and request the restriction of its use instead; where we no longer need the Personal Data for the purposes of the processing, but we are required by you to retain it for the establishment, exercise or defense of legal claims; where you objected to processing (as detailed below) pending the verification whether our legitimate grounds override your request. You may exercise your right by sending us email at [email protected].
Right to Data Portability: You have the right to get a copy of your Personal Data in a portable format and, to the extent technically feasible, readily usable format that allows you to transmit the Personal Data to another entity without hindrance. We will select the format in which we provide your copy. You may exercise your right by sending us email at: [email protected].
Right to Withdraw Consent/Opt-Out/Object (Specifically in the US the Right to Opt-Out from: (i) Selling Personal Data; (ii) Targeted Advertising; and (iii) Profiling): When the lawful basis for processing your Personal Data is your consent, you may withdraw such consent at any time. This can be done by sending us your request at: [email protected], however, for certain Personal Data processing, your rights can be exercised independently.
You further have the right to object to the processing of Personal Data, in the event the basis for processing is our legitimate interests. However, we will be permitted to continue the processing if our legitimate interests override your rights, or when processing is necessary to establish, exercise, or defend a legal claim or right.
